Description

The aim of the project is to strengthen the activities of the society "Ogres Attīstības Biedrība" (OAB) by preparing its Development strategy, improving public information and communication tools, competences of members and financial sustainability.

Within the framework of the project, OAB Strategy for year 2022-2026and the Action Plan for 2022 will be developed so that they are not only internal planning documents for organization, but presentation materials for local residents, government, non-governmental and private sector and partners. OAB plans to continue the research of historical buildings, therfore the aim of the experience exchange events is to get acquainted with the activities of other public organizations in this field in Latvia. Second important task is to find a vision of the development opportunities of the Creative Quarter PASTS, technical, financial opportunities, the range of services provided, its short-term and long-term development priorities. Necessary inspiration and experience exchange about technical, marketing, financial and cooperation solutions with existing Creative and Art centers in Latvia. Within the project - furnishing outdoor area of the Creative Square PASTS - so that the Creative Square (located on the main pedestrian street in the city center) attracts interest and becomes one of the central places with various thematic art and cultural classes and events. In order to reach a larger audience, the OAB will create its own website, where will be possible not only to place information about society and its activities, but to accumulate information and attract potential new members, also. Consultations on financial management and legal issues will allow OAB to arrange issues of finance, employment and internal rules of procedure according to legislation. Members of OAB will increase competencies in financial management issues, communication on social networks and with journalists and implementation of M&E in theborganization.
